Understanding Today's Crossword Puzzle

The answer to the clue "Quasimodo's creator" being "HUGO" is a reference to Victor Hugo, the renowned French author. Here's why this clue leads to the answer:

  1. Quasimodo: Quasimodo is a famous literary character known for being the hunchbacked bell ringer of Notre Dame Cathedral in Victor Hugo's novel "The Hunchback of Notre-Dame."
  2. Creator: The term "creator" in this clue implies the author of the novel where Quasimodo originates.
  3. HUGO as the Answer: Putting these two elements together, when looking for the individual who brought Quasimodo to life through writing, Victor Hugo fits perfectly as the answer to this clue.
Therefore, in the context of literature and famous characters, the answer "HUGO" aligns with the clue "Quasimodo's creator."
